THE BUTTER INDUSTRY.

Great Expansion. Per Press Association. New Plymouth, January 26. The Gorina, loading to-day, takes 16,521 boxes of butter and 6016 cases of cheese from New Plymouth, the value approximately being £50,000, bringing the total exports from here this month, including the amount still in store, to £120,088. Altogether this month 44, GOG boxes of butter have been shipped and 1000 are remaining in the cold store. The increase in the value of the January exports compared with last year represents :—Butter £-16,017 ; cheese £7748. Including shipments from the Patea grading works the total value of butter and cheese sent from Taranaki this month is estimated to reach £182,08A An all round shrinkage in volume is now reported, hut it is still well ahead of any previous year.
